Who We Are:
Mitchell County Regional Health Center is in Osage, Iowa located in Mitchell County, which has a population of 10,600 people. MCRHC is a 25-bed critical access hospital, including a Level 4 Trauma Center Emergency Room seeing 3,200 visits annually. The Surgical Services department performs over 1,300 procedures annually, including specialties General Surgery, Orthopedics, ENT, Urology, Ophthalmology, Pain management, and Podiatry.
We are proud to share our strong tradition of excellence, progress and solid economic performance. Founded more than 75 years ago as a community hospital, today we operate three clinics, 24/7 emergency services, inpatient and outpatient medical/surgical services. We have invested millions in facility upgrades just in the last few years. With more than 225 employees and average tenure of eight years, our growth continues with multiple expansion projects currently underway. We are an affiliate of MercyOne.

About The Job:
A Midlevel Provider is an Advanced Registered Nurse Practitioner (ARNP) or a Physician Assistant (PA) in the Mitchell County Regional Health Center Physician Hospital Organization (PHO) who provides quality patient care in the outpatient clinic setting, Emergency Department, and outlying communities. The ARNP works collaboratively with primary care physicians, and the PA works under the supervision of approved physicians. The duties of the Midlevel Provider cannot be rigidly defined, but the following description characterizes common expectations of the position. The primary responsibilities may not be interpreted to prohibit functions not specifically identified.
